    ‘I Loved It’: Michigan State HC Tom Izzo Praises Nebraska Fans Court Storming

    It was a defensive grudge match in Lincoln but one that ended with No. 13 Nebraska staying undefeated, as it got a 58-56 win at home over No. 9 Michigan State and a signature court storming after the buzzer sounded.

    But did Michigan State head coach Tom Izzo take issue with the court storming?

    The chaotic victory over Michigan State was the second ranked win of the season for Nebraska, the opposite being a highway victory in opposition to now-No. 20 Illinois on Dec. 13. In the meantime, it was simply Michigan State’s second lack of the season, the opposite coming at house in opposition to now-No. 6 Duke on Dec. 6.

    Subsequent up for the 14-0 Cornhuskers is a highway matchup in opposition to the Ohio State Buckeyes on Monday night time (6:30 p.m. ET on FS1 and the FOX Sports app).
